Explore the Rich History of Dallas

Dallas boasts a remarkable history that spans several centuries, making it an intriguing destination for history enthusiasts. Founded in the 1840s, the city quickly evolved from a humble trading post into a thriving urban hub. Its prime location facilitated trade and transportation, significantly boosting its development. The finding of oil in the early 20th century pushed Dallas further into national prominence, reshaping its economy and population.

Tourists can discover notable landmarks such as the storied West End district, where the vestiges of bygone eras integrate naturally with present-day advancement. The Sixth Floor Museum at Dealey Plaza provides a detailed look at the life and assassination of President John F. Kennedy, illuminating a defining chapter in United States history. Moreover, the metropolis's varied cultural roots are expressed through its architecture and neighborhoods. Overall, Dallas provides a rich tapestry of historical narratives that captivate those enthusiastic to investigate its storied past.

Majestic Reunion Tower

Rising prominently against the city's skyline, the Majestic Reunion Tower acts as a testament of the vibrant spirit of the city. This remarkable landmark provides guests breathtaking panoramic views from its viewing deck, located 470 feet above the ground. As a premier landmark of Dallas, the tower showcases a unique design reminiscent of a massive disco ball, illuminated by colorful LED lights at night. Visitors can savor a spinning restaurant, providing a dining experience unlike any other. The tower likewise acts as a hub for cultural events, making it a gathering place for locals and tourists alike. With its breathtaking architecture and memorable vistas, the Majestic Reunion Tower authentically embodies the spirit of Dallas, welcoming everyone to discover its allure.

Wide Range of Sporting Events Provided

Many sporting events throughout the year highlight the thriving athletic culture of Dallas. The city hosts a variety of professional teams, including the NBA's Dallas Mavericks and the NFL's Dallas Cowboys, both of which draw large crowds and passionate fans. Also, Major League Baseball's Texas Rangers feature thrilling games at Globe Life Field, while the NHL's Dallas Stars enthrall ice hockey enthusiasts. Beyond professional sports, Dallas embraces college athletics, highlighting teams from the University of Texas at Arlington and Southern Methodist University. In addition, the city embraces unique sporting events, such as professional soccer matches with FC Dallas and various motorsports. This wide array of sporting events guarantees that every sports fan experiences something to cheer for in Dallas.

Common Questions and Answers

What Is the Best Time of Year to Visit Dallas?

The optimal time to explore Dallas falls during spring or autumn. These seasons offer mild temperatures and vibrant events, making outdoor activities enjoyable. Travelers can take in the city's unique character while avoiding the sweltering summer heat.

What Are My Options for Getting Around Dallas Without a Car?

People traveling to Dallas can utilize multiple public transit alternatives such as the DART light rail, bus routes, and rideshare platforms like Uber and Lyft. Riding a bike or walking are also excellent alternatives in many neighborhoods and attractions.
